The Arabic alphabet is the script used for writing languages such as Arabic, Persian, Urdu, and others. Arabic is written from right to left, and is written in a cursive style of script. There are 28 basic letters in the Arabic alphabet. Just as different handwriting styles and typefaces exist in the Roman alphabet, there are Arabic scripts in a number of different Arabic calligraphy styles, including Naskh, Nastaʼlīq, Shahmukhi, Ruqʼah, Thuluth, Kufic, and Hejazi. After the Latin alphabet, the Arabic writing system is the second-most widely used alphabet around the world.Arabic Alphabet. Enclopaedia Britannica online. Retrieved on 2007-11-23.
The alphabet was first used to write texts in Arabic — most importantly, the Qurʼan, the holy book of Islam. With the spread of Islam, it came to be used to write many other languages, even outside of the Semitic family to which Arabic belongs. Examples of non-Semitic languages written with the Arabic alphabet include Persian, Urdu, Pashto, Baloch, Malay, Balti, Brahui, Panjabi (in Pakistan), Kashmiri, Sindhi (in Pakistan), Uyghur (in China), Kazakh (in China), Kyrgyz (in China), Azerbaijani (in Iran) and Kurdish in Iraq and Iran. In order to accommodate the needs of these other languages, new letters and other symbols were added to the original alphabet. (See Arabic alphabets of other languages below.)
The Arabic alphabet consists of 28 basic letters. Adaptations of Arabic script for other languages, such the Malay Arabic script, may have additional letters. There are no distinct upper and lower case letter forms.
Both printed and written Arabic are cursive, with most of the letters directly connected to the letter that immediately follows. A few letters do not connect with the following letter, even in the middle of a word. Some letters look almost the same in all four forms, while others show more variety. In addition, some letter combinations are written as ligatures (special shapes), including lam-ʼalif.Rogers, Henry (2005). Writing Systems: A Linguistic Approach. Blackwell Publishing, p. 135. Many letters look similar but are distinguished with dots placed above or below their central part. These are regarded as an integral part of the letter, not as diacritics — the dots distinguish completely different letters (and sounds). For example, the Arabic letters transliterated as b and t have the same basic shape, but b has one dot below, ب, and t has two dots above, ت.
The Arabic alphabet is an "impure" abjad—long vowels are written, but short ones are not—so the reader must be familiarized with the language in order to restore the missing vowels. However, in editions of the Qurʼan or in didactic works vocalization marks are used, including a sign for vowel omission called the sukūn and one for consonant gemination called šadda.
There are two collating orders for the Arabic alphabet. The original abjadī order (أبجدي) derives from the order of the Phoenician alphabet, and is therefore similar to the order of other Phoenician-derived alphabets, such as the Latin alphabet. In the hejāʼī order (هجائي), similarly-shaped letters are grouped together (see the next section). The latter is used wherever lists of names and words need to be sorted, as in phonebooks, classroom lists, and dictionaries. However, when letters are used for numbering, the abjadī order is exclusively used.
The special abjadī order (in two slightly different variants) was devised by matching an Arabic letter of the fully consonant-dotted 28-letter Arabic alphabet to each of the 22 letters of the Aramaic alphabet (in their old Phoenician alphabetic order, also used by the Hebrew alphabet) — and adding the six remaining Arabic letters at the end.

Despite no longer being used as the standard order of the alphabet, the abjadī order is still used in things such as lists and outlines where a ordinal system of designating points of information or questions other than numbers is required. In other words, whereas a list in English might call its first point A its next point B, its next point C, then D, then E and so on down to Z, even today a list in Arabic would typically call its first point أ, then ب, then ج, د, ﻫ and so on down to ﻍ, rather than أ, ب, ت, ث, ج, and so on down to ي, as the modern order might suggest. The order is, also, still used in Modern Arabic mathematical notation when allocating variable names. For example, when the letters أ (ʼalif) and ب (bāʼ) have already been used for variable names, conventionally, the next letter to be used would be ج (ǧim). Major software packages, like word processors, lack the capability of sorting or generating numbered lists according to this order.

The Arabic script is cursive, and all primary letters have conditional forms for their glyphs, depending on whether they are at the beginning, middle or end of a word, so they may exhibit four distinct forms (initial, medial, final or isolated). However, six letters have only isolated or final form, and so force the following letter (if any) to take an initial or isolated form, as if there were a word break.
For compatibility with previous standards, Unicode can encode all these forms separately; however, these forms can be inferred from their joining context, using the same encoding. The table below shows this common encoding, in addition to the compatibility encodings for their normally contextual forms (Arabic texts should be encoded today using only the common encoding, but the rendering must then infer the joining types to determine the correct glyph forms, with or without ligation). There are 29 primary letters.
The names of the Arabic letters can be thought of as abstractions of an older version where they were meaningful words in the Proto-Semitic language.

The broken alif (ʼalif maqṣūra), commonly encoded as Unicode 0x0649 (ى) in Arabic, is sometimes replaced in Persian or Urdu, with Unicode 0x06CC (ی), called "Persian yeh", in accordance with its pronunciation in those languages. The glyphs are identical in isolated and final form (ﻯ ﻰ), but not in initial and medial position, where the Persian yeh gains two dots below (ﻳ ﻴ). The ʼalif maqṣūra has neither an initial nor a medial form. Although this is the common situation, the problem is not so simple, and no solution has been met yet as of September, 2007.Unicode problems; Arabic on Linux
The only compulsory ligature is lām + ʼalif. All other ligatures (yāʼ + mīm, etc.) are optional.

Short vowels are generally not written in Arabic, except in sacred texts (such as the Qurʼan, where they must be written) and sometimes in teaching material. These are known as vocalized texts.
Short vowels are occasionally marked where the word would otherwise be ambiguous and could not be resolved simply from context, or simply wherever they are aesthetically pleasing.
Short vowels may be written with diacritics placed above or below the consonant that precedes them in the syllable. All Arabic vowels, long and short, follow a consonant; contrary to appearances, there is a consonant at the start of a name like Ali — in Arabic ʻAliyy — or of a word like ʼalif.

A long a following a consonant other than a hamza is written with a short a sign on the consonant plus an ʼalif after it; long i is written as a sign for short i plus a yāʼ; and long u as a sign for short u plus a wāw. Briefly, aā = ā, iy = ī and uw = ū. Long a following a hamza may be represented by an ʼalif madda or by a free hamza followed by an ʼalif.

An Arabic syllable can be open (ending with a vowel) or closed (ending with a consonant).
When the syllable is closed, we can indicate that the consonant that closes it does not carry a vowel by marking it with a diacritic called sukūn ( ْ ) to remove any ambiguity, especially when the text is not vocalized. A normal text is composed only of series of consonants; thus, the word qalb, "heart", is written qlb. The sukūn indicates where not to place a vowel: qlb could, in effect, be read qalab (meaning "he turned around"), but written with a sukūn over the l and the b (قلْبْ), it can only have the form qVlb. This is one step down from full vocalization, where the vowel a would also be indicated by a fatḥa: قَلْبْ.
The Qur’an is traditionally written in full vocalization.
